Former 90 Day Fiancé star Varya Malina shared with fans that she plans on joining the United States National Guard. The Russian reality personality has been making headlines lately after she publicly sided with fellow former franchise star Geoffrey Paschel, who was recently found guilty of kidnapping and domestic assault against another ex of his. Varya and Geoffrey appeared together on 90 Day Fiancé: Before the 90 Days season 4.

After the show aired, it was unclear if the Russian/American couple was still together. However, when Varya announced her support for Geoffrey, she also shared that the pair had still been in a relationship when the Tennessee man was convicted. Since this announcement, Varya, who was not previously super active on social media, has been posting Reels and photos on Instagram every day. Her posts have included constant videos and memories from before Geoffrey was found guilty, as well as other random posts, such as the Russian 90 Day Fiancé star's trick for making money on Reels.

Varya's latest post reveals a career choice that's confusing to many 90 Day Fiancé fans: she's joining the U.S. National Guard. The star posted a video on Instagram Reels of herself dancing while her announcement flashed on the screen. In the caption, Varya admitted that she never expected herself to be making this life choice and that she knew many fans likely did not expect it either. A few fans asked her in the comments why she decided to join the National Guard, to which Varya replied that she can't tell them because it would be too long of a story.

Varya's fellow 90 Day Fiancé cast member Natalie Mordovtseva, who was also slammed by fans for publicly supporting Geoffrey following his conviction, shared her encouragement for Varya in the comments. Natalie said that Varya would be "awesome" in the National Guard. Lots of other fans also shared support in the comments, many of them also sharing that they are either active military or veterans themselves. In her Instagram Story posted the same day, Varya showed herself returning to a hotel room after what she described as a "long, hard day." Her Reels video was also filmed in a hotel room, and she shared in a comment that she had to wake up at 4:30 a.m. the following day for training.

If Varya was already in a hotel room preparing to train to be in the National Guard, that gives 90 Day Fiancé fans the clue that joining the National Guard was not a sudden decision and that Varya has been planning it for a while. It's unlikely that Varya will appear in future franchise shows because of her public involvement with a convicted felon. So viewers curious about her new adventure will have to follow her on social media in order to keep up.
